IDEA ACADEMY SAN JUAN

IDEA ACADEMY SAN JUAN is a Title I public charter elementary school that is part of the IDEA PUBLIC SCHOOLS school district, located in SAN JUAN, TX with about 853 students offering grade levels from Pre-Kindergarten to 5th Grade. Student demographics can be found below. A Title I school provides supplemental financial assistance to school districts for children from low-income families. Its purpose is to provide all children significant opportunity to receive a fair, equitable, and high-quality education. With about 42 teachers, IDEA ACADEMY SAN JUAN has a student/teacher ratio of about 20:1. The national average for public schools is about 15:1. A lower student/teacher ratio is a key factor that determines how much a teacher can devote his/her time to each individual student thus improving, or reducing (in the event of a higher student/teacher ratio) the attention each student is given for their educational needs.

IDEA ACADEMY SAN JUAN is a tuition-free public charter school located in San Juan, Texas, serving students in grades PK–5. As part of the wider IDEA Public Schools network, the academy is founded on the mission of providing a rigorous, college-preparatory education to students in underserved communities. The campus emphasizes a structured academic environment designed to instill strong foundational skills in literacy and mathematics while fostering a culture of high expectations and character development.

The school is well-known for its "College for All" philosophy, which begins in the early grades by exposing students to university-themed classroom environments and goal-oriented academic tracking. By utilizing small-group instruction and data-driven teaching methods, IDEA ACADEMY SAN JUAN focuses on closing the achievement gap and preparing every student for long-term success in middle school, high school, and ultimately, higher education. * A public charter school is a publicly funded school that is typically governed by a group or organization under a legislative contract with the state, the district, or another entity. The charter exempts the school from certain state or local rules and regulations.

1 The National School Lunch Program (NSLP) provides eligible students with free or reduced-price lunch

2 Title I, Part A (Title I) of the Elementary and Secondary Education Act provides supplemental financial assistance to school districts for children from low-income families.
